Output e228c462b74679111999dd6b3d7e71c58b4930d6c8449075da35cf20f8ff29b5:0

value
580385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6a9b384593109e09fe1dcf502a3d5354ae04727 OP_EQUAL
address
3MG3peKN5x3bG7KD3qwwKst4do8humAAGu
transaction
e228c462b74679111999dd6b3d7e71c58b4930d6c8449075da35cf20f8ff29b5
spent
true